By CNBCTV18.com The move could lead to India becoming a major telecom player, rivalling the world’s leading telecom equipment manufacturers in the US, Finland, Sweden and China India could have indigenously developed and designed fifth-generation (5G) equipment, including core and radio components, commercially available by March next year, a top telecom official said. 5G Core is a central conduit that establishes secure connectivity to the radio access network that connects with end users. The state-owned R&D firm is expected to launch 5G standalone (SA) mode by 2023. #india #5G Source:- CNBCTV18 In recent years, India has been trying to reduce its dependence on foreign network equipment providers and become a telecom gear manufacturer. Sweden’s Ericsson, Finland’s Nokia, the US's Qualcomm and China’s Huawei are big players in the telecom gear market at present.
